History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on January 10
| Year | Event |
|---|---|
| 9 | The Western Han dynasty ends when Wang Mang claims that the divine Mandate of Heaven called for the end of the dynasty and the beginning of his own, the Xin dynasty. |
| 69 | Lucius Calpurnius Piso Licinianus is appointed by Galba as deputy Roman Emperor. |
| 236 | Pope Fabian succeeds Anterus to become the twentieth pope of Rome. |
| 1072 | Robert Guiscard conquers Palermo in Sicily for the Normans. |
| 1430 | Philip the Good, the Duke of Burgundy, establishes the Order of the Golden Fleece, the most prestigious, exclusive, and expensive order of chivalry in the world. |
| 1475 | Stephen III of Moldavia defeats the Ottoman Empire at the Battle of Vaslui. |
| 1645 | Archbishop William Laud is beheaded for treason at the Tower of London. |
| 1776 | American Revolution: Thomas Paine publishes his pamphlet Common Sense. |
| 1791 | The Siege of Dunlap's Station begins near Cincinnati during the Northwest Indian War. |
| 1812 | The first steamboat on the Ohio River or the Mississippi River arrives in New Orleans, 82 days after departing from Pittsburgh. |
